Rumah >pembangunan bahagian belakang >C++ >Bagaimana untuk menulis sistem pusat membeli-belah dalam talian yang mudah menggunakan C++?

Bagaimana untuk menulis sistem pusat membeli-belah dalam talian yang mudah menggunakan C++?

WBOY
WBOYasal
2023-11-02 14:31:02854semak imbas

Bagaimana untuk menulis sistem pusat membeli-belah dalam talian yang mudah menggunakan C++?

Bagaimana untuk menulis sistem pusat membeli-belah dalam talian yang mudah menggunakan C++?

Dengan perkembangan Internet, e-dagang telah menjadi salah satu cara utama orang ramai untuk membeli-belah. Bagi memenuhi keperluan membeli-belah pengguna, adalah sangat perlu untuk membangunkan sistem pusat beli-belah dalam talian yang mudah dan praktikal. Artikel ini akan memperkenalkan cara menggunakan C++ untuk menulis sistem pusat membeli-belah dalam talian yang mudah.

1. Analisis keperluan

Sebelum mula menulis sistem pusat membeli-belah dalam talian, anda perlu menjalankan analisis keperluan terlebih dahulu. Berdasarkan ciri fungsi pusat membeli-belah dalam talian, kami boleh menentukan keperluan berikut:

  1. Pendaftaran pengguna dan log masuk: Pengguna boleh mendaftar akaun dan menggunakan akaun untuk log masuk ke pusat membeli-belah dalam talian sistem.
  2. Pelayaran produk: Pengguna boleh menyemak imbas produk di pusat membeli-belah dan melihat maklumat terperinci tentang produk.
  3. Pengurusan troli beli-belah: Pengguna boleh menambahkan produk yang mereka ingin beli pada troli beli-belah dan mengurus troli beli-belah (seperti menambah atau memadam produk, mengubah suai kuantiti, dsb.).
  4. Pesanan dan pembayaran: Pengguna boleh memilih item dalam troli beli-belah untuk membuat pesanan dan menyelesaikan proses pembayaran.
  5. Pengurusan pesanan: Pengguna boleh melihat maklumat pesanan mereka dan melakukan operasi berkaitan (seperti membatalkan pesanan, mengesahkan penerimaan, dll.).
  6. Pengurusan belakang: Pentadbir pusat membeli-belah boleh menguruskan maklumat produk, maklumat pesanan, dsb.

2. Reka bentuk sistem

Berdasarkan analisis permintaan, kita perlu menjalankan reka bentuk sistem. Reka bentuk khusus merangkumi aspek berikut:

  1. Reka bentuk pangkalan data: Pangkalan data perlu direka bentuk untuk menyimpan maklumat produk, maklumat pengguna, maklumat pesanan, dsb.
  2. Reka bentuk antara muka pengguna: Menyediakan pengguna dengan antara muka yang mesra supaya mereka boleh melakukan pelbagai operasi dengan mudah.
  3. Bahagian modul berfungsi: Bahagikan sistem kepada berbilang modul berfungsi, setiap modul bertanggungjawab untuk fungsi yang sepadan.
  4. Interaksi antara modul: Wujudkan cara interaksi yang baik antara modul yang berbeza.

3. Pelaksanaan sistem

Sebelum melaksanakan sistem, kita perlu memilih persekitaran dan alatan pembangunan yang sesuai. Di sini, kami memilih untuk menggunakan bahasa C++ untuk pembangunan dan menggunakan Visual Studio sebagai alat pembangunan.

Seterusnya, kita boleh mengikuti langkah berikut untuk melaksanakan sistem:

  1. Buat pangkalan data: Mengikut keperluan, mereka bentuk dan mencipta pangkalan data, termasuk maklumat pengguna jadual, jadual maklumat produk, jadual maklumat pesanan, dsb.
  2. Reka bentuk antara muka pengguna: Gunakan perpustakaan grafik C++ untuk mereka bentuk antara muka mesra pengguna supaya pengguna boleh melakukan pelbagai operasi dengan mudah.
  3. Pengendalian pangkalan data: Tulis kod C++ yang sepadan untuk merealisasikan interaksi dengan pangkalan data, termasuk pendaftaran pengguna, log masuk, menyemak imbas produk, pengurusan troli beli-belah, penempatan dan pembayaran pesanan, pengurusan pesanan, dsb.
  4. Interaksi modul: Mengikut pembahagian modul berfungsi, tulis kod untuk merealisasikan interaksi antara modul yang berbeza untuk memastikan operasi normal sistem.

4. Ujian sistem

Selepas selesai menulis sistem, kami perlu menjalankan ujian sistem untuk memastikan fungsi dan prestasi sistem dapat memenuhi keperluan. Ujian khusus termasuk ujian unit, ujian kefungsian, ujian prestasi, dsb. untuk memastikan kualiti sistem.

5. Pengoptimuman sistem

Selepas ujian sistem, beberapa masalah atau ruang untuk pengoptimuman mungkin ditemui. Berdasarkan keputusan ujian, kami boleh melakukan pengoptimuman sistem yang disasarkan untuk meningkatkan prestasi sistem dan pengalaman pengguna.

6. Ringkasan

Melalui langkah di atas, kita boleh menggunakan C++ untuk menulis sistem pusat membeli-belah dalam talian yang mudah. Sudah tentu, ini hanyalah contoh mudah, dan sistem pusat beli-belah dalam talian yang sebenar mungkin lebih kompleks dari segi fungsi dan butiran. Tetapi melalui pengenalan di atas, saya percaya anda sudah memahami keseluruhan proses dan idea pembangunan.

Saya harap artikel ini dapat membantu kajian dan amalan anda, dan saya doakan anda berjaya dalam menulis sistem pusat membeli-belah dalam talian yang lengkap!

Atas ialah kandungan terperinci Bagaimana untuk menulis sistem pusat membeli-belah dalam talian yang mudah menggunakan C++?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an:
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n